Bachelor's or Master's degree in Special Education, active Special Education Teacher license and minimum 1+ years Special Education Teacher exper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.
A K-12 educational institution in Crandall, TX is seeking an experienced Special Education Teacher to support diverse student needs across multiple grade levels. This contract position offers the opportunity to contribute to a dynamic learning environment focused on inclusive practices and individualized instruction. Key responsibilities include: Providing resource inclusion services primarily at the elementary level Delivering homebound and inclusion support for middle school students Supporting the LIFE program for elementary students with significant disabilities Implementing the PASS (behavior) program in elementary classrooms to address behavioral goals Collaborating with general education teachers, specialists, and families to develop and assess Individualized Education Programs (IEPs) Utilizing various instructional strategies to meet the unique learning and behavioral needs of students with disabilities Desired qualifications: Valid teaching certification with a focus on Special Education Experience working across multiple grade levels (elementary and middle school) Knowledge of inclusion models and behavior intervention strategies Strong communication and collaboration skills to work effectively with multidisciplinary teams Commitment to fostering an inclusive and supportive educational environment This contract assignment offers the chance to make a meaningful impact through tailored instruction and behavioral support. The role is designed for a dedicated professional passionate about promoting equity and success for students with disabilities.
